We’ve had two really good experiences where they came through very quickly, and one where we solved the situation ourselves
One was a simple issue far from home very early on a Sunday morning, and we were on our way with no delay. Another was at night returning from a trip, almost home, but needed to go into the Mercedes dealer on one of those giant sized big-vehicle trucks. Big relief, and that tow probably covered the cost of our roadside assistance membership for a couple of years.
But one time they couldn’t find anyone nearby available in the boondocks on a Sunday for a slideout issue and since we were in a campground, suggested we try again Monday. We eventually found a mobile repair lady who came, did a temporary fix to get us home, charged us just a small fee.
Two out of three isn’t bad. We renew every year, glad to have the coverage.
